Here is a summary of last night's 24t7:

The night started out with great food and music as usual. After that I gave a talk about the importance of having close Friends, using the friendship of David and Jonathan (1 Samuel) as an example. the main point of the night was to show how important it is to have a close friend or friends who you share your faith and values, friends that will encourage and support you but also hold you accountable and help you get back on the right track when you stumble. Of course there is no better example of this than Jesus himself, who befriended sinners. He accepted them but not their sin and helped them to change.

We discussed this further in our small groups and kids were challenged to strive for these kinds of friendships. they were encouraged to find friends and adults who would hold them accountable and build them up in their faith.

We end every night with a song called Tell the World. This week my prayer is that these youth go out and tell the world about Jesus through their friendships.
